The body panels, are they different between the 3 door and 5 door, specifically these panels:-
Front/Rear Bumpers
Tailgate
Front wings

I wanted to repair some scratches but through it might be cheaper to replace a few parts but wanted to ensure my naivety wasn't a costly one!

If you have a couple of dents/scratches on the front wings it can be much cheaper to have them repaired, I had a PDR technician repair the dent and the magic of polish got rid of the scratches. I too first looked at replacing a front wing which FIAT ePER quoted at £107 which isn't so bad, the downside is that these are unpainted and the expensive bit is colour matching them to the car. Colour matching both bumpers, a tailgate and the wings would be pretty eye watering.

Personally I'd look to repair them first, if they are beyond this give Autolusso a call as they stock a wide range of panels and replacement bits, you might even find one the same colour.

As for the 3/5 door differences, I believe the front panels are the same along with the tailgate and bumpers, it's just the doors, side panels and rear quarter panel that's different I think. Brand new panels are usually delivered with just the top-coat and it would be down to you to have them painted and matched to the car. And that's where you spend the money.
